Recent Trends in Yoga Travel Resources

Over the past few years, the market for yoga adventure resources has expanded significantly. Traveling yogis now have access to curated online directories, mobile apps that combine route planning with asana sequences, and retreat booking platforms that emphasize off-the-grid locations. Many resources now integrate wellness certifications and environmental sustainability criteria, responding to a growing preference for low-impact travel. Subscription-based “yoga travel kits” — including portable mats, instructional cards, and eco-friendly props — have also gained traction among practitioners who value convenience without sacrificing practice quality.

Background: How the Niche Developed

Yoga adventure resources emerged from the intersection of two established markets: adventure tourism and yoga retreats. Early offerings were limited to printed guidebooks and word-of-mouth retreat recommendations. As digital connectivity improved, solo practitioners began sharing detailed itineraries and gear reviews on forums. By the mid-2010s, specialized websites began aggregating yoga-friendly hostels, national parks with dedicated yoga decks, and instructors willing to lead mobile workshops. Today, the ecosystem includes nonprofit directories that highlight ethical accommodations and for-profit platforms that offer user ratings for remote practice spots.

User Concerns When Selecting Resources

  • Reliability of information: Travelers worry about outdated or promotional listings. Many prefer resources that clearly note update dates and authentic user reviews.
  • Suitability for different levels: Beginners need resources that flag beginner-friendly trails and gentle classes; advanced practitioners seek challenging sequences and rugged locations.
  • Safety and accessibility: Resources that detail emergency contacts, terrain difficulty, and cell service reliability are increasingly valued, especially for solo female travelers.
  • Cost transparency: Hidden retreat fees, gear rental markups, and last-minute cancellation policies remain common frustrations. Users prioritize platforms that list full pricing upfront.
  • Cultural respect: Many yogis seek resources that emphasize respectful engagement with local communities and avoid over-commercialization of sacred sites.

Likely Impact on the Yoga Travel Sector

As the availability of specialized yoga adventure resources grows, independent travelers may rely less on large retreat operators. This could shift revenue toward smaller, locally run studios and guides who list their services on these platforms. In parallel, gear manufacturers are likely to introduce more packable and multi-use yoga accessories designed for varying climates and terrains. The increased transparency around safety and ethics may also raise expectations for all yoga tourism providers, pressuring them to adopt clearer policies. For resource creators, quality assurance becomes a key differentiator — platforms that verify listings through inspections or user verification might gain trust more quickly than those relying solely on self-reported data.

What to Watch Next

  • Integration of real-time conditions: Apps that combine weather, trail updates, and local yoga events in one interface are likely to become more common.
  • Community-driven vetting: Watch for resources that allow practitioners to rate not just facilities but also instructional quality and environmental impact.
  • Regulatory attention: As the niche matures, some countries may begin requiring permits or liability waivers for outdoor yoga sessions listed on these platforms.
  • Cross-sector partnerships: Collaborations between yoga resource platforms and national park services or eco-lodge networks could create more structured adventure packages.
  • Accessibility improvements: Resources that cater to practitioners with disabilities or to families with children may represent the next underserved segment.
